In a significant victory for Disney, the entertainment giant has successfully navigated a copyright infringement lawsuit concerning its popular animated film, “Moana.” The lawsuit, centered around allegations of copyright violation, had the potential to impact Disney’s extensive home entertainment business. However, the court’s decision in favor of Disney ensures that the company can continue distributing the film without disruption. The lawsuit was filed by a small independent filmmaker who claimed that Disney’s “Moana” had infringed on their copyrighted work. The filmmaker alleged that the storyline, characters, and themes of the Disney film bore striking similarities to their own creation. Such allegations, if proven, could have led to significant financial penalties and a halt in the distribution of “Moana” across various platforms. Disney, however, maintained a strong defense throughout the proceedings. The company argued that “Moana” was an original work, inspired by Polynesian mythology and cultural stories. Disney’s legal team presented comprehensive evidence showcasing the extensive research and unique creative processes that went into developing the film. This strategy played a crucial role in swaying the court’s decision in their favor. After a thorough examination of the presented evidence, the court ruled that Disney did not infringe on any copyright with “Moana.” The judge highlighted the distinct differences between the two works in question, emphasizing Disney’s originality and creative efforts. This ruling effectively dismissed the allegations and reaffirmed Disney’s right to continue distributing “Moana.” The verdict comes as a relief for Disney, particularly in safeguarding its home entertainment business. With “Moana” being one of Disney’s significant animated successes, a ruling against the company could have disrupted its distribution channels, impacting revenue streams. Moreover, it reinforces Disney’s standing as a creator of original content, helping to maintain its reputation in the entertainment industry. In a groundbreaking move to enhance the movie-going experience, Fandango and Regal Cinemas have teamed up to offer a seamless way for movie lovers to purchase tickets and concessions. This partnership aims to streamline the process of buying Regal movie tickets and concession items through Fandango’s platform, making your next theater visit more enjoyable and efficient (Fandangonow Pre Order). Gone are the days of standing in long lines at the concession stand or scrambling to find the best seats last minute. With the collaboration between Fandango and Regal, customers can now pre-order their favorite snacks and drinks along with their movie tickets. This innovative approach not only saves time but also ensures that moviegoers can focus on what truly matters – enjoying the film. The process is simple and user-friendly. When you purchase your Fandango tickets online, you will be prompted with an option to add concession items to your order. Select from a range of popular snacks, including popcorn, candy, and soft drinks, all available for pre-order. Once you’ve made your selections, your order will be ready for pickup at the designated Regal location. The Fandango Regal pre-orders offer several advantages that enhance the overall cinema experience. Firstly, it reduces wait times by allowing customers to skip the concession lines. Secondly, it provides a contactless transaction option, an increasingly important feature in today’s health-conscious environment.
